How has the economic crisis affected press freedom in Venezuela?
The economic crisis has negatively impacted press freedom in Venezuela, with a deterioration in working conditions for journalists, closure of independent media outlets, and restrictions on freedom of expression. The concentration of the media in the hands of the State and censorship have limited access to plural and truthful information, contributing to misinformation and lack of transparency in the country.
What are the legal consequences of intellectual property theft in Colombia?
Intellectual property theft in Colombia refers to the unauthorized appropriation of copyrights, patents, trademarks or other protected intellectual assets. Legal consequences may include civil legal actions, damages awards, administrative sanctions, intellectual property protection measures, and additional actions for violation of intellectual property rights and unfair competition.
How is child support regulated in cases of children with disabilities in Peru?
Alimony in cases of children with disabilities in Peru is established taking into account the special needs of the child. The judge can consider the additional costs associated with the disability and determine an appropriate amount.
